英文摘要
The focus of proposed research is understanding a broad class of***dynamical phenomena in strongly coupled gauge theories and***gravity. One the gauge theory side, I am interested in questions of***preparations of non--equilibrium states; quantum quenches and***subsequent thermalization; entropy production in dynamical evolution;***local and non-local probes of thermalization; late--time behaviour of***generic states in Quantum Field Theories. On the gravity side I am***interested in gravitational collapse, specifically the conditions***under which the event horizon is formed; does turbulence play a role***in horizon formation? Additionally, I have a long--standing interest in***constructing inflationary models in String Theory, and understanding***the origin of the Universe. In this view, I was particularly excited***by recent experiment announcement for the detection of the primordial***gravitational waves. ***To make progress in any of these fundamental problems, they must be considered***together: holographic correspondence of Maldacena provides a mapping***between Quantum Field Theory and Gravitational problems. I believe***that combining the intuition and previous research in these seemingly***different sub-fields of theoretical physics would lead to further***breakthroughs. It it natural to separate the project into three***sub-themes:***1) From Thermodynamics to Hydrodynamics to Non--equilibrium Gauge***Theory Plasma. Here I intend to continue development of program of***holographic quantum quenches I have been actively involved with in the***last 3 years. A major effort is related to designing novel numerical***codes that would be able to address the dynamics of quenching systems***without homogeneity and isotropy assumptions. I hope to shed light on***definition of entropy far -from- equilibrium, describe in details***various local and non--local probes of non--equilibrium dynamics. I plan***to perform simulations of ``collisions'' in realistic (confining)***models of holographic gauge/string correspondence. The results should***be of interest to researchers involved in experimental heavy -ion***programs at RHIC and LHC.******2) Gravitational Collapse, Horizon Formation and Turbulence. Here, I***continue to further my program of gravitational collapse in***asymptotically AdS. The main fundamental question I hope to answer***relates to constraints on states in strongly coupled systems that,***despite interactions, fail to equilibrate and thermalize. I hope my***research would help better understand recent Hawking suggestion***concerning the role of turbulence in Black Hole information paradox.******3) Inflation and Origin of the Universe in String Theory I intend to***refine the models of Inflation in String Theory that I worked on in***the past. The motivation for this is the hope that as the potential***discovery of primordial gravitation waves suggests the high scale of***inflation, there might be signatures of String Inflation hidden in***BICEP 2 data.**
